Getting the best vacation rental experience:
Money saving strategies:
- In the Charleston area area, The earlier you can book, the easier your search will be. The most desirable properties are booked very early. Booking your rental property six - twelve months before your travel dates is recommended. Winter holidays are excellent times to plan and reserve your vacation rental.
- Summer is the most expensive season in Charleston. To find the most suitable vacation home within your budget, we recommend reserving in Fall or Spring months. You'll benefit from lower rates, better selection, warm weather and the absence of large crowds at the beach and popular Charleston area attractions. Many vacationers use this method to reserve larger homes, or to book a beach front vacation rental that would otherwise be unaffordable during the Summer. Speaking of the off-season, don't overlook Winter holidays for a Charleston area vacation! Who wouldn't love a holiday on the coast? Thanksgiving and Christmas are great times to gather with friends and family at the beach.
- Owners sometimes offer discounts or promotional rates for veterans and active duty military. Remember to ask your host or property manager if special offers are available for your family before you book.
- Management companies and individual rental owners usually offer customers an option to add vacation insurance protection. Trip insurance, which normally will cost you between 1% - 5% of the stay price, offers visitors reimbursement of costs for any missed days as a result of personal medical-related issues or weather, as well as hurricane evacuation charges, such as an unexpected hotel overnight or additional fuel expenses. Trip insurance is definitely a life-saver if the unforeseen happens. Ask your property manager for additional information.
- Look for your local Charleston area visitors guide when you arrive at the rental property. If your rental property doesn't have a copy, you can find them at local grocery stores, shopping centers, and visitor centers. In addition to great local stories, visitor guides contain money saving offers on nearby accommodations, tours and attractions.

Tips to have a smooth stay:
- We recommend storing the owner's contact information in your smartphone and wallet.
- Ask questions. You may need instructions for a fireplace, intercom or kitchen appliance. Contact your property manager. They are there to help! A brief telephone call can prevent many problems.
- Ensure you protect the rental owner (and your stuff!) by locking the rental while you are gone, just like you would at home.
- At Check-in, record any damages to the rental property and immediately contact the owner. Record all correspondence just in case a dispute arises.
- Respect the neighborhood. Often times, adjacent homes are occupied by permanent residents. Respecting late-night quiet hours and parking regulations reduces conflict and allows everyone to enjoy their day.
- Don't forget to... Ask a local resident! Neighbors can often help you find exactly what you're looking for. Who better to ask where to get the best breakfast in town, have a great night out, or the best spots for crabbing?
- Don't leave anything behind! Before you drive away, walk through the rental to make sure you've collected all personal items. Make sure to check closets, dressers, garages, and bathrooms for hidden belongings. Remove everything from the refrigerator and take or dispose of leftovers.
- Record a video to document the condition of the property.
- Did your group have a fantastic stay? Many rental home management companies make it easy for clients to provide feedback. If your property and/or property management company was fantastic, they always love to hear your praise. If anything was out of order and they failed to address it reasonably, or if the vacation rental wasn't described correctly, you'll want to make a note as part of your feedback.
